About Jumbunna

Jumbunna Institute for Indigenous Education and Research (Jumbunna) at UTS assists the University to contribute effectively to Australia's educational and social development by making UTS staff and students aware of Indigenous Australian cultures and associated issues. It is committed to improving the quality of teaching and research at UTS by facilitating active links with the Indigenous community, higher education institutions, and other professions with particular emphasis on Australia's growth as a multi-cultural nation.

About the role

The Institute Operations Officer is a key position within the Jumbunna Institute-Research professional staff team and will be responsible for ensuring the effective and efficient management of its core functions including finance, human resources, procurement, records management, and Work Health and Safety obligations. The position will work collaboratively with central university units to deliver on strategic and operational priorities.
